Step-by-Step Guide: How to Start My Car from My Chevrolet App
Starting your car from the Chevrolet app offers convenience, especially on cold days. Follow these steps to ensure a smooth and easy process.
Downloading and Installing the App
- Get the App: Find the Chevrolet app in the Apple App Store or Google Play Store.
- Install the App: Tap on “Install” and wait for the download to finish.
- Open the App: Launch the app once installation is complete.
Connecting to Your Vehicle
- Create an Account: Sign up with your email and password. Follow the prompts to verify your email address.
- Link Your Vehicle: Enter your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) in the designated section of the app. You can find the VIN on your vehicle’s registration or inside the driver’s side door frame.
- Confirm Connection: The app will verify your vehicle and confirm its connection. Ensure your car is compatible, typically models from 2011 onward.
- Access Remote Start: Open the Chevrolet app and navigate to the “Remote Start” option on the home screen.
- Start Your Car: Tap the “Start” button. The app communicates with your vehicle, starting the engine when successfully connected.
- Monitor Engine Status: The app provides real-time feedback on whether the engine starts successfully. If it doesn’t, check that your vehicle is in park and the hood is closed.
By following these steps, starting your Chevrolet remotely becomes quick and effortless, allowing you to enjoy a warm car when you’re ready to drive.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
Starting your Chevrolet car with the app is usually straightforward, but sometimes issues arise. Knowing how to handle these common problems can ensure a smoother experience.
App Connectivity Issues
- Check Your Internet Connection: Confirm that your smartphone has an active internet connection. A weak connection can prevent the app from communicating with your vehicle.
- Bluetooth Settings: Ensure that Bluetooth is enabled on your phone. This feature helps maintain communication between the app and the vehicle.
- Restart the App: Close the app completely and restart it to refresh the connection. Sometimes, the app needs a quick reboot to function properly.
Vehicle Compatibility Concerns
- Confirm Model Year: Make sure your vehicle is a 2011 model or newer, as older models may not support the app.
- Verify Connected Services: Check if your Chevrolet includes the necessary connected services by reviewing the Owner’s Manual or using the Chevrolet website.
Login and Account Problems
- Reset Password: If you can’t log in, try resetting your password through the app’s login interface. Follow the instructions sent to your email to create a new password.
- Email Verification: Ensure you’ve verified your email after account creation. If not, locate the verification email sent to you and follow the provided link.
Engine Start Failures
- Ensure the Vehicle is in Park: The car must be in “Park” mode to start remotely. Double-check your vehicle’s gear setting.
- Battery Status: A low battery in the vehicle can prevent engine start. Check your battery levels and recharge it if necessary.
- Obstruction Factors: Walls, large objects, or extreme weather can interfere with the app’s signal. Try moving closer to your vehicle if you experience issues.
App Updates
- Check for Updates: Always keep the app updated to the latest version to ensure better performance and compatibility. Regular updates can fix bugs and improve functionalities.
- Operating System Compatibility: Ensure your smartphone’s operating system is compatible. Update to the latest version of iOS or Android if needed.
- Customer Support: If problems persist, contact Chevrolet customer support for assistance. They can provide specific guidance based on your situation.
- User Manuals and FAQs: Consult the app’s FAQ section or the Owner’s Manual for additional troubleshooting tips tailored to your vehicle model.
These troubleshooting tips streamline the process and help you get back on the road quickly.
